<strong>West</strong> <strong>Penn</strong> <strong>Wire</strong>: N AT I O N A L E L E C T R I C A L C O D E<br />
The National Electrical Code is a set of guidelines written to govern the installation of wiring and equipment in<br />
commercial buildings and residential areas. These guidelines are revised every three years to ensure the safety of<br />
human beings as well as property against fires and electrical explosion associated with electrical installations.<br />
Although the National Electrical Code contains the suggested regulations governing the proper installation of wire<br />
and cable, each state, city, county and municipality has the option to adopt part of the code, all of the code or write<br />
one of its own. The local inspectors have the authority to approve or disallow any installation based on the National<br />
Electrical Code or on the local code. The NEC is a good reference when questions arise about proper techniques for<br />
particular installations, but local authorities should be contacted for verification.<br />
